Hey there!&nbsp; We have a campaign that has been running for several months and would like to open it up to few more people. This isn't a typical "find the quest" adventure style campaign. We are looking for players that enjoy playing deep characters with flaws and room to grow along with the ability to make them interesting to everyone else at the table. People that like to delve into the PC's mind and overcome personal emotional trials all the while confronting the disadvantages the setting delivers into a positive outcome. What we are looking for are people that enjoy playing serious characters similar to The Last of Us rather than action heroes/silly voiced Resident Evil types. This campaign has a serious, mature tone. Fart jokes at the funeral is best left to other games. It's a harsh and gritty Post Apocalypse sandbox campaign with a strong focus on surviving in a strange and dangerous place where your meaningful choices have a lasting impact. The ramifications of death in a game like Call of Duty are rarely if ever felt but in this campaign death can be a scaring experience both physically and emotionally. If you have enthusiasm for this kind of play please keep reading and click the link below! We will use an indie skill based system called Threshold ( <a href="https://tinyurl.com/yavoce39" rel="nofollow">https://tinyurl.com/yavoce39</a> ). This will allow players to build the character the way they want rather than have a pre-defined class based path. The system is lethal and is grounded in more "low level" reality over high adventure/action movie heroes. Player Responsibilities: Must gather intel. The world is harsh and many try to take advantage of others especially the desperate. Locations, settlements and virtually all NPCs are guarded. Don't look to the GM to fill in the blanks, warn you of impending danger by giving tells, or where/how to gather info. Proactively engineer desired results whether social or practical. Examples of this are to not to look for a magic negotiation roll to solve a trade when you have nothing to offer an NPC. Nor expect the GM to provide handouts to help you achieve your goal. YOU MUST CREATE YOUR OWN WAY TO SUCCESS. Remain in character! What you say over the mic matters. Speaking about what you would like to do OOC doesn’t count and NPCs will react to it. SET GOALS & WORK TOWARDS THEM! Think of what you want for your character and how they can fit into the group. Don't hide your goals. This is not a single player game. Talk with the other PCs and make sure you all have similar goals and work to make it happen. Your personal goals should be supporting the groups main goal. Must be 21+ years old. Campaign Focus Thrust into a dangerous place will you make allies? How will you find supplies? What kind of home will you have? Combat is lethal. Healing is slow. Remaining in character as much as possible while being true to your character's motivations, goals, flaws and personality.
